****Job Description:**** An opportunity for a **Supply Chain & Quality Manager** has arisen within Airbus Defence and Space, Getafe (Madrid). The selected candidate will join the **TAOPOZ Team**. Supply Chain Quality Management plays a decisive role at Airbus; it is much more than an aviation law requirement to ensure compliance with quality requirements by our suppliers. In order to offer our customers the highest quality and provide an excellent on-time service, we demand the same from our supply chain. In this role, you will be responsible for one of the most important interfaces to our global supply chain, working in a multidisciplinary environment in close contact with Procurement, Engineering, Production, and Programme lines. **RESPONSIBILITIES** The main tasks of the jobholder will be: * **Act** as the primary operational interface with global suppliers (including multiple functions and critical sub-tiers). * **Assess** supplier capacity, capability, and performance during the tendering phase and contribute to the final selection decision. * **Manage** supply chain and quality aspects of contracts, ensuring On-Time, On-Quality, and On-Cost (OToQoC) performance. * **Ensure** supplier quality approval and compliance with required certifications in coordination with relevant internal stakeholders. * **Monitor** new product introductions, Transfer of Work (ToW), and changes to ensure industrial qualification maturity before the serial phase. * **Identify** supplier industrial risks, propose mitigation actions, and manage short-term recovery plans or performance improvement projects. **SKILLS** Is your profile aligned to the following list of skills?
